a <br />2 <br />Chairman Carey asked Mr. Gledhill to draft the occupancy tax <br />proposal and the Board would decide after they meet with Chapel Hill <br />whether or not it will be submitted. <br />John Link reported on two zoning cases involving civil penalties. <br />Christy B. Merritt and Carl Swanson both have made significant progress <br />in cleaning up their property. He recommended they be allowed another <br />month to bring their property into compliance. There was a consensus <br />to allow these two property owners an additional 30 days. Commissioner <br />Insko asked that a review of this process be made an agenda item in the <br />near future. <br />III. AUTHORIZATION OF THE RSVP RENEWAL APPLICATION ALRD AGREEMENT <br />The Board approved the RSVP resolution as stated below, the <br />application and agreement with ACTION and authorized the Chair to sign <br />these documents when they are received. This agreement is for the <br />period July 1, 1991 through June 30, 1992.
